Onboarding note: undo/redo in Sketchloom. The diagram editor keeps a bounded history of 200 operations per canvas, persisted to the Replay service so undo survives reconnects. If users report lost history, check the Replay writer's queue depth before restarting anything, since a restart flushes unacknowledged entries. The writer authenticates to Replay with a service secret loaded from its environment file at boot, and that secret belongs on the line immediately after this one.

vault entry, yajop-bafop: ARCHIVE_KEY3=8d4

Leadership Review Briefing — Second-Source Supplier Search

Ventara's sole-source exposure on the Kestrel valve line remains our top supply risk. Procurement has screened four candidates; two (Ostrell Fabrication, Dunmere Castings) passed initial audits. Qualification costs estimated at 140k, recoverable within three quarters via pricing leverage. Decision requested by month-end. The strategic rationale is summarized below.

board note of tafof-kawif: The northern region missed its Gorir quota by 26.8 percent last quarter. Kasokox Systems plans to lower the Briael list price by 25.3 percent in September. The board signed off on a budget of $280.5 million for Project Aldok. The renewal with Rusiusek Group closes at $466.1 million a year, 61.8 percent above the last contract.

### Audit item 14 — Websocket reconnect loop

Verify that the Tidemark client no longer retries with zero backoff after an auth failure. Confirm jittered exponential backoff caps at 60s and that stale session tokens are refreshed before reconnect. Check the regression test added in the fix. The engineer accountable for this item is listed below.

account owner for fajep-yagef: Kasix Eliiel

Runbook: GarageGlance occupancy feed

If the Harborview Deck occupancy feed goes stale (no updates for 5+ minutes), first check the sensor gateway health page. Green but stale usually means the aggregator queue is backed up; restart the aggregator via the ops console and counts should recover within two minutes. If spots show negative numbers, force a full recount from the camera snapshots. When escalating to engineering, include the trace token shown below.

session token of yawif-kahof = htk9_dd6996ed6